Physical materials that can be applied to different types of equipment. These are always tied to an Asset Template.
Field
|
Type
|
Default
|
Description
|
Label
|
String
|
|
A unique label for your material. Do not alter after setting up your material!
|
Name
|
String
|
|
A unique name for your material
|
Base color name
|
String
|
White
|
Name of the color.
|
Base color
|
Color
|
White
|
The color itself.
|
Tintable
|
Boolean
|
True
|
Whether this material can be dyed.
|
Weight
|
Integer
|
400
|
Weight in grams assuming the item the material is tied to is about the size of a shirt.
|
Level
|
Integer
|
1
|
Min level for the material to show up in drops.
|
Stat Bonus
|
Integer
|
0
|
Lets you add some extra stats to the random asset generator. Not currently used in the main game.
|
Hit Sound
|
String
|
|
Alternate hit sounds for the item. Can be a URL to an OGG file or a CSV of OGG files. Leave it empty to use the item tags to auto pick a sound for you.
|
Stats
|
Int
|
0
|
Lets you tweak stats for the base item. You can use negative values. Try to keep the total sum to 0, or up to +4 for high level items.
|
Tags
|
Tag
|
|
Tags to add to the player while wearing an item with this material. Starting with as_
